trampoline_count fills all trampoline attachment slots for a single
target function and verifies that one extra attach fails with -E2BIG.
It currently targets bpf_modify_return_test, which is also used by
modify_return and get_func_ip_test. When those tests run in parallel,
they can contend for the same per-function trampoline quota and
cause unexpected attach failures. This issue is currently masked by
harness serialization.
Add a dedicated bpf_trampoline_count_test target and switch
trampoline_count to use it. This keeps the test semantics unchanged
while isolating it from other modify_return-based selftests, so it no
longer needs to run in serial mode. Remove the TODO comment as
well.
